Are suggies known to have hip problems? The one that I got from a lady a few days ago just doesnt look right to me. He is going to the vet tomorrow but just wondering if this is a problem with alot of gliders? He is skinny in his back end. You can feel his hip bones real good. His hair is missing on the back end, and when he crawls around he is constanly dropping urine. almost like a weak bladder. So again just wondering if anyone has this problem?

Most everything about this poor glider is not healthy. The urine seems not so out of the ordinary but the baldness and the hip problem is not good. As in your other post I wrote about diet related problems. The hip problem sounds like hind leg paralysis "HLP" from low calcium in his diet. Talk to your Vet about this. I've heard sometimes they can give a shot for calcium and then of course you changing his diet to include the proper ratio of Ca:PH 2:1 should hopefully stop and maybe reverse some of this. This little glider needs to be seen by an exotic vet asap. Hind Leg Paralysis is fairly common in gliders and is caused by poor diet.

However, if caught in time it can be reversed. Here is an article on HLP:

Yogurt is a source of calcium - but not all are high in calcium.

When a glider gets this bad, yogurt is not going to fix things. Hopefully, this glider has seen a vet already.
